Minutes We Spent

Days, weeks, years, many hours included Minutes we spent above, now saddened, deluded Moments shared, in private, continual we Deceived be, looking past I see From the day we first met Attraction, absorbed through music shared Revealing the hurts of our past Captured, our hearts now care Days, weeks, in trance The unbalance our lives created Minutes we spent above Meeting in Glasgow our lives related To the Island you had to go back This reality you always said You knew you were going back home Knowing our reality was dead Weeks and months passed by Always knowing I was by your side Monetary problems caused a rift I helped in my wanting stride Then came the day The day I travelled to you You asked so many times This feeling of feeling true At Arricife we met Having told me your with someone else For the weeks, months, years that passed by I was discarded, left on a shelf But on that Thursday, in the apartment we We released what had happened before Tears, cuddles That had captured the Glasgow, thee Then that call on the Friday morning Because of the history between You were barred from interacting This two who loved so keen Sound asleep early Monday morning 3.15am, when it again began Upset, wanting to see me Desiring two, to become lovingly one Moments once again were shared In depth, and loving sighs Making love for hours and hours Amidst our saddened cries We awoke later that day An agenda of life your to meet Now cancelled, Kissing, cuddling, you desire we greet We spent this Monday in bed Talking, kissing, about many things Wishing that we were to be And what our future would bring But you had already chosen On the week that I was due out to fly For these days, weeks, months I've wasted on you For your tomorrows, you'll internally cry Goodbye. <*>
